Dr Ellie Murray, ScD (@epiellie) 's Twitter Profile Photo

Change from baseline in the placebo arm of an RCT is not a valid way to estimate the placebo effect. Why? Because you can’t estimate the effect of placebo without any data on the counterfactual “no placebo” outcome. Read more here: academic.oup.com/aje/article/19…
